Braised pork with beer and onions

Earlier this month I read that despite the ongoing heatwave there has been a somewhat unexpected increase in sales of ready-made meals like shepherd's pie due to an effect called reverse comfort eating. At the end of a hot-and-sweaty day, people are reaching for stews and casseroles rather than the salads you would perhaps expect. It doesn’t surprise me as after 20 years in pub kitchens I know how popular a Sunday roast was even on the hottest of days. Now, if you are craving something hearty and comforting, then today’s slow-cooked pork recipe will hopefully hit the spot.
